You can get a compact ACOG with M16 base.  That way you can mount it on your carry handle or buy and adaptor and mount it on your rail.  They are great little scopes that look great on ARs.  There are 1.5x, 2x, and 3x models, with three different recticle choices (dot, triangle, crosshair).  Target acquisition, even at short ranges, is very quick.  The additional accurancy makes an AR much more fun to shoot.

If you are looking for a more powerful scope, a 3.5-10 or 4.5-14 Leupold is within your price range.
